Bitcoin Shows Strong Accumulation Signs as Price Nears $110,000

Bitcoin (BTC) is exhibiting significant signs of accumulation, particularly from large institutional players, even as its price approaches the formidable $110,000 mark. This robust buying behavior suggests underlying strength in demand, hinting at a potential continuation of its upward trajectory despite current high valuations.

Whale Activity Signals Confidence

On-chain data reveals a notable surge in Bitcoin inflows into whale wallets, with some reports indicating a substantial increase in accumulation from large holders. This aggressive buying by major entities, often referred to as "whales," signals a strong conviction in Bitcoin's future price performance. Such accumulation at elevated price points suggests these influential investors view current levels as attractive entry opportunities rather than exit points.

Supply Dynamics Point to Reduced Selling Pressure

Further reinforcing the accumulation narrative, Bitcoin reserves on centralized exchanges continue to decline. This reduction in exchange supply suggests that fewer BTC are available for immediate sale, thereby decreasing potential selling pressure. The ongoing transfer of Bitcoin from short-term holders to long-term holders, a phenomenon known as "HODL mode," indicates that stronger hands are absorbing the circulating supply, a historically bullish sign for the asset.

Institutional Demand Remains a Key Driver

A significant factor contributing to this accumulation trend is the persistent demand from institutional investors, notably via spot Bitcoin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s). These regulated investment vehicles continue to attract substantial capital, directly boosting Bitcoin's demand without requiring investors to directly manage cryptocurrency. This consistent institutional interest solidifies Bitcoin's position as a legitimate and increasingly mainstream asset class.

Market Outlook Amidst Key Levels

As Bitcoin consolidates around the $105,000 to $110,000 range, its ability to decisively break above the $110,000 to $112,000 resistance levels will be crucial. Should it overcome these barriers, analysts project a potential push towards $115,000 and even $120,000. The current market sentiment, while showing "greed," is not yet at "extreme greed" levels, suggesting there might still be room for further price expansion.
